The Android App Development Process: Step-by-Step
Ideation and Requirement Analysis
Every app begins with an idea. Developers collaborate with clients to understand their goals, target audience, and core functionalities. This phase involves brainstorming, research, and creating a detailed project blueprint.
UI/UX Design
The design phase focuses on crafting an intuitive user interface and seamless user experience. Wireframes and prototypes are created to visualize the app’s layout, ensuring it aligns with user preferences and brand identity.
Development and Coding
This is where the app comes to life. Developers use programming languages like Kotlin or Java to build the app, integrating features such as APIs, third-party tools, and databases.
Testing and Deployment
Thorough testing is conducted to identify and fix bugs. From usability to security, every aspect is examined. Once approved, the app is deployed to the Google Play Store and made available to users.

Common Challenges in Android App Development
Diverse Device Ecosystem
Android powers a vast range of devices, from premium smartphones to budget models, each with unique screen sizes, resolutions, and hardware capabilities. Ensuring an app performs seamlessly across this diverse ecosystem is a complex task.
Multiple OS Versions
Unlike iOS, Android users operate on various OS versions simultaneously. Developers must optimize apps for older versions while incorporating features of the latest releases, balancing innovation with accessibility.
Ensuring App Security
Data Breaches and Cyber Threats
Android apps are vulnerable to cybersecurity threats like data breaches, malware attacks, and unauthorized access. Developers must implement strict security protocols to protect sensitive user data.
Secure API Integration
APIs are integral to app functionality but can also pose security risks if not properly secured. Encrypting APIs and monitoring their usage ensures safe integration with external services.
Maintaining High Performance Across Devices
Handling Limited Resources
Some Android devices have limited processing power and memory. Apps must be optimized to deliver high performance even on low-end devices, ensuring accessibility for all users.
Battery Efficiency
Resource-intensive apps can drain battery life quickly. Developers must design apps to minimize energy consumption, improving user satisfaction and retention.
Testing Across Platforms
Device Compatibility Testing
Testing apps across multiple devices and OS versions is time-intensive but critical. Simulators and physical devices are used to ensure compatibility and functionality.
Identifying Performance Bottlenecks
Performance issues, such as slow loading times or crashes, can impact user experience. Rigorous testing identifies bottlenecks and ensures smooth operation.

FAQs
1. How Long Does It Take to Develop an Android App?
The development timeline depends on the complexity of the app. Simple apps may take 3–4 months, while feature-rich apps can require 6–12 months or more.
2. What Is the Cost of Professional App Development?
Costs vary based on features, design, and complexity but typically range from $10,000 to $100,000 or more for a high-quality app.
3. How Are Apps Tested for Quality?
Developers use automated and manual testing methods, including functional, performance, and security testing, to ensure the app meets quality standards.
